    The PIX is a real firewall. The WRT has a firewall which mostly protects the router itself. People prefer to buy a "SPI firewall router" instead of a simple "router" even though the router firewall does nothing or little to protect the LAN. The only firewall configurations on the WRTs you can usually do is on the Access Restrictions tab. But that's usually all. The LAN itself is not protected by the firewall. You would notice this if you had a public IP subnet and ran it through the WRT: the LAN would be fully exposed to the internet. Some routers have a few functions like protection against denial of service attacks or similar. But even then this often filters only the traffic targeted at the router and not the LAN.
    The common protection of your LAN you have on the WRT is because you use private IP addresses inside your LAN and the router does NAT. However, NAT is not a security mechanism but a mechanism to solve the problem that you can only have a single public IP address but want to use multiple computers, which is why you have to use private IP addresses. Current NAT implementations usually drop unsolicited incoming traffic because they don't know to which IP address in the LAN to send it to. But the notion of NAT is to deliver and to allow connectivity. This has nothing to do with security or a firewall.
    Thus, if you want to use a real firewall use the PIX. On the PIX you can configure the traffic which is allowed to enter the LAN and which not. It is far superior in this respect to the WRT. However, as it is a older model, I cannot tell how fast the PIX is. You should be able to find the old data sheets of the PIX somewhere on the cisco website. They should mention the possible throughput. I guess it won't be an issue.
    To me another point for the PIX are the VPN capabilities which allow you to securely access your LAN while you are on the road.
    Of course, you must know how to configure the PIX correctly. It is a complex device and can be configured pretty much for anything you like. This means of course if you do it wrong you may end up with little or no security.

    Intermittent problems
    Intermittent problems are often a result of interference. Interference can be caused by other networks in the neighbourhood or from household electrical items.
    You can download and install iStumbler (NetStumbler for windows users) to help you see which channels are used by neighbouring networks so that you can avoid them, but iStumbler will not see household items.
    Refer to your router manual for instructions on changing your wifi channel or adjusting your multicast rate.
    There are other types of problems that can affect networks, but this is by far the most common, hence worth mentioning first. Networks that have inherent issues can be seen to work differently with different versions of the same software. You might also try moving the Apple TV away from other electrical equipment.
    Consistent Problems
    A frequent cause of consistent failure to enable AirPlay or HomeSharing at all, is the service being blocked on the network. Make sure your network isn't hidden, has a unique name, that MAC address authentication is disabled, security is set to use WPA 2 Personal and that there is only one router/device acting as a DHCP server and providing NAT services.
    Make sure your router/computer allows access over the following ports
    Port
    Type
    Protocol
    Used By
    80
    TCP
    HTTP
    AirPlay
    443
    TCP
    HTTPS
    AirPlay
    554
    TCP/UDP
    RTSP
    AirPlay
    3689
    TCP
    DAAP
    iTunes/AirPlay
    5297
    TCP
    Bonjour
    5289
    TCP/UDP
    Bonjour
    5353
    TCP/UDP
    MDNS
    Bonjour/AirPlay
    49159
    UDP
    MDNS (Win)
    Bonjour/AirPlay
    49163
    UDP
    MDNS (Win)
    Bonjour/AirPlay
    Refer to your router manual/manufacturer for any settings that are specific to that model.
    Another frequent cause of consistent failure to enable AirPlay or HomeSharing at all, is security software, in many cases configuring it correctly, disabling it or even uninstalling it can help, but in some cases the security software can cause problems that simply reconfiguring, disabling or uninstalling cannot reverse.
    If you are consistently unable to activate AirPlay, have tried all the steps in this article and have security software installed on your system, you might benefit from contacting its provider or participating in any online forums they run to discuss the matter with them.
